Raw Materials

The production of stainless steel pipes and tubes begins with the selection of high-quality raw materials. Stainless steel is an alloy primarily composed of iron, chromium, and nickel, with small amounts of other elements such as manganese, silicon, and carbon. The specific composition of the alloy depends on the desired properties of the final product, such as corrosion resistance, strength, and ductility.

The raw materials are typically sourced from reputable suppliers and undergo strict quality control measures to ensure they meet the required specifications. The most common forms of raw materials used in the production of stainless steel pipes and tubes are stainless steel billets or slabs, which are large, rectangular pieces of metal.

Melting and Casting

Once the raw materials have been selected, they are melted in a furnace at high temperatures. The melting process is crucial as it allows the different elements to combine and form a homogeneous alloy. Electric arc furnaces or induction furnaces are commonly used for this purpose.

During the melting process, various additives may be introduced to the molten metal to adjust its composition and properties. For example, additional chromium may be added to enhance the corrosion resistance of the stainless steel. Once the desired composition has been achieved, the molten metal is poured into molds to form billets or slabs.

Hot Rolling

After the casting process, the billets or slabs are heated to a high temperature and then passed through a series of rolling mills. Hot rolling is a process that involves reducing the thickness and increasing the length of the metal by passing it between two or more rolls. This process helps to improve the mechanical properties of the stainless steel, such as its strength and ductility.

The hot rolling process also helps to eliminate any internal defects or impurities in the metal. As the metal is rolled, it is gradually shaped into the desired form, such as a round or square cross-section. The hot-rolled stainless steel pipes and tubes are then cooled and cut to the appropriate lengths.

Cold Drawing

In some cases, the hot-rolled stainless steel pipes and tubes may undergo a cold drawing process to further improve their dimensional accuracy and surface finish. Cold drawing involves pulling the metal through a die at room temperature to reduce its diameter and increase its length. This process helps to produce pipes and tubes with a more precise and uniform size.

The cold drawing process also helps to improve the mechanical properties of the stainless steel, such as its hardness and strength. During the cold drawing process, the metal is subjected to high levels of stress, which causes it to work harden. This results in a stronger and more durable product.

Heat Treatment

Heat treatment is an important step in the production of stainless steel pipes and tubes. It helps to improve the mechanical properties of the stainless steel, such as its strength, hardness, and ductility. Heat treatment involves heating the metal to a specific temperature and then cooling it at a controlled rate.

There are several different types of heat treatment processes that can be used, depending on the desired properties of the final product. For example, annealing is a heat treatment process that involves heating the metal to a high temperature and then cooling it slowly. This process helps to relieve internal stresses in the metal and improve its ductility.

Quenching and tempering are other heat treatment processes that can be used to improve the strength and hardness of the stainless steel. Quenching involves heating the metal to a high temperature and then cooling it rapidly, while tempering involves heating the metal to a lower temperature and then cooling it slowly.

Surface Finishing

The surface finish of stainless steel pipes and tubes is an important consideration, especially in applications where aesthetics or corrosion resistance are critical. There are several different surface finishing options available, depending on the desired appearance and performance of the final product.

One of the most common surface finishing options is polishing, which involves using abrasive materials to smooth the surface of the metal and give it a shiny, reflective finish. Polishing can be done using a variety of techniques, such as mechanical polishing, chemical polishing, or electrochemical polishing.

Another surface finishing option is passivation, which involves treating the surface of the stainless steel with a chemical solution to remove any free iron or other contaminants and create a protective oxide layer. Passivation helps to improve the corrosion resistance of the stainless steel and prevent the formation of rust or other forms of corrosion.

Quality Control

Throughout the production process, strict quality control measures are implemented to ensure that the stainless steel pipes and tubes meet the required specifications. Quality control begins with the selection of raw materials and continues through each stage of the production process, from melting and casting to surface finishing.

Various testing methods are used to evaluate the quality of the stainless steel pipes and tubes, such as chemical analysis, mechanical testing, and non-destructive testing. Chemical analysis is used to determine the composition of the stainless steel and ensure that it meets the required specifications. Mechanical testing is used to evaluate the strength, hardness, and ductility of the stainless steel, while non-destructive testing is used to detect any internal defects or impurities in the metal.
